ان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ید


توزیع گنو/لینوکس اوبونتو ۲۰ ساله شد 🎉

نویسنده موضوع: خطا در کامپایل Kplayer 0.7  (دفعات بازدید: 1173 بار)

0 کاربر و 1 مهمان درحال مشاهده موضوع.

lomion

  • مهمان
خطا در کامپایل Kplayer 0.7
« : 26 بهمن 1387، 01:10 ب‌ظ »
سلام

داشتم برنامه Kplayer ر از  روی سورس کامپایل می کردم. کتابخونه‌هایی که فکر می کردم لازمن ر نصب کردم. اما هنوز یه سری خطا دارم. نمی دونم چه بسته‌های دیگه‌ای ر نصب کنم.
اینم خروجی کامپایل: (ازجایی گذاشتم که خطا شروع شده)
 Linking CXX shared module ../lib/libkplayerpart.so                                                                                                         
cd /home/lomion/Downloads/kplayer-0.7/kplayer && /usr/bin/cmake -E cmake_link_script CMakeFiles/kplayerpart.dir/link.txt --verbose=1                       
/usr/bin/c++  -fPIC  -Wnon-virtual-dtor -Wno-long-long -ansi -Wundef -Wcast-align -Wchar-subscripts -Wall -W -Wpointer-arith -Wformat-security -fno-exceptions -fno-check-new -fno-common -Woverloaded-virtual -fno-threadsafe-statics -fvisibility=hidden -fvisibility-inlines-hidden -O2 -DNDEBUG -DQT_NO_DEBUG -Wl,--enable-new-dtags -Wl,--fatal-warnings -Wl,--no-undefined -lc  -shared -Wl,-soname,libkplayerpart.so -o ../lib/libkplayerpart.so CMakeFiles/kplayerpart.dir/kplayerpart_automoc.o CMakeFiles/kplayerpart.dir/x11.o CMakeFiles/kplayerpart.dir/kplayerwidget.o CMakeFiles/kplayerpart.dir/kplayerslideraction.o CMakeFiles/kplayerpart.dir/kplayerprocess.o CMakeFiles/kplayerpart.dir/kplayersettings.o CMakeFiles/kplayerpart.dir/kplayerproperties.o CMakeFiles/kplayerpart.dir/kplayeractionlist.o CMakeFiles/kplayerpart.dir/kplayerengine.o CMakeFiles/kplayerpart.dir/kplayerpropertiesdialog.o CMakeFiles/kplayerpart.dir/kplayerpart.o /usr/lib/libkdecore.so.5.2.0 /usr/lib/libkparts.so.4.2.0 /usr/lib/libkdeui.so.5.2.0 -lQt3Support /usr/lib/libkde3support.so.4.2.0 /usr/lib/libkparts.so.4.2.0 -lQt3Support /usr/lib/libkio.so.5.2.0 /usr/lib/libkdeui.so.5.2.0 /usr/lib/libkdecore.so.5.2.0 -lQtDBus -lQtCore -lQtSvg -lQtNetwork -lQtXml -lQtGui -Wl,-rpath,::::::::::::::::::::::::::::::::::::::::::::::::::::::::::                                                                                               
CMakeFiles/kplayerpart.dir/x11.o: In function `KPlayerX11GetKeyboardMouseState(unsigned int)':                                                             
x11.cpp:(.text+0x43): undefined reference to `XQueryPointer'                                                                                               
CMakeFiles/kplayerpart.dir/x11.o: In function `KPlayerX11UnmapWindow(unsigned int)':                                                                       
x11.cpp:(.text+0xce): undefined reference to `XUnmapWindow'                                                                                                 
CMakeFiles/kplayerpart.dir/x11.o: In function `KPlayerX11MapWindow(unsigned int)':                                                                         
x11.cpp:(.text+0xee): undefined reference to `XMapWindow'                                                                                                   
CMakeFiles/kplayerpart.dir/x11.o: In function `KPlayerX11SetInputFocus(unsigned int)':                                                                     
x11.cpp:(.text+0x12a): undefined reference to `XSetInputFocus'                                                                                             
CMakeFiles/kplayerpart.dir/x11.o: In function `KPlayerProcessX11Event(_XEvent*)':                                                                           
x11.cpp:(.text+0x2d9): undefined reference to `XGetAtomName'                                                                                               
x11.cpp:(.text+0x300): undefined reference to `XFree'                                                                                                       
CMakeFiles/kplayerpart.dir/x11.o: In function `KPlayerX11UnmapWindow(unsigned int)':                                                                       
x11.cpp:(.text+0xdc): undefined reference to `XFlush'                                                                                                       
CMakeFiles/kplayerpart.dir/x11.o: In function `KPlayerX11MapWindow(unsigned int)':                                                                         
x11.cpp:(.text+0xfc): undefined reference to `XFlush'                                                                                                       
CMakeFiles/kplayerpart.dir/x11.o: In function `KPlayerX11SetInputFocus(unsigned int)':
x11.cpp:(.text+0x145): undefined reference to `XFlush'
collect2: ld returned 1 exit status
make[2]: *** [lib/libkplayerpart.so] Error 1
make[2]: Leaving directory `/home/lomion/Downloads/kplayer-0.7'
make[1]: *** [kplayer/CMakeFiles/kplayerpart.dir/all] Error 2
make[1]: Leaving directory `/home/lomion/Downloads/kplayer-0.7'
make: *** [all] Error 2
پ. ن. دارم روی کی دی ای ۴.۲ کامپایل می کنم. روی سیستم ۶۴ بیتی